¿Qué es VBA y macros?
Preguntado por: Javier Becerra | Última actualización: 29 de noviembre de 2023Puntuación: 4.1/5 (32 valoraciones)
Si alguna vez ha usado macros en Excel, ha usado Visual Basic para aplicaciones (VBA). VBA es un código de programación legible por humanos (y editable) que se genera cuando graba una macro. Cuando ejecuta una macro, es este código el que Excel lee para reproducir sus acciones.
¿Que se entiende por VBA?
Visual Basic para Aplicaciones (VBA) es un lenguaje de programación de Office con el que es posible crear aplicaciones nuevas y funciones personalizadas para ahorrar tiempo en programas como Excel.
¿Qué lenguaje usa las macros de Excel?
Estas macros están escritas con el lenguaje VBA o Visual Basic Applications, lanzado en 1993 por Microsoft. Este se trata de un lenguaje de programación basado en eventos que está integrado en todo el paquete office.
¿Cómo se crea una macro en Excel?
Haga clic en Archivo > Opciones > Barra de herramientas de acceso rápido. En la lista Elegir comandos de, haga clic en Macros. Seleccione la macro a la que desea asignar un botón. Haga clic en Agregar para mover la macro a la lista de botones de la barra de herramientas de acceso rápido.
¿Cómo ejecutar macros VBA Excel?
Seleccione la macro que desea ejecutar colocando el cursor en cualquier lugar de la macro y presione F5o, en el menú, vaya a Ejecutar > Ejecutar macro.
¿Qué es VBA? | Curso completo de VBA para Macros
42 preguntas relacionadas encontradas
¿Cómo se usa la macro?
Una macro es una acción o un conjunto de acciones que se puede ejecutar todas las veces que desee. Cuando se crea una macro, se graban los clics del mouse y las pulsaciones de las teclas. Después de crear una macro, puede modificarla para realizar cambios menores en su funcionamiento.
¿Qué es ejecutar una macro?
Una macro es una acción o un conjunto de acciones que puede usar para automatizar tareas. Las macros se graban en el Visual Basic para Aplicaciones de programación. Siempre puede ejecutar una macro haciendo clic en el comando Macros de la pestaña Programador de la cinta de opciones.
¿Dónde se almacenan las macros en Excel?
En Windows 10, Windows 7 y Windows Vista, este libro se guarda en la carpeta C:\Usuarios\nombre de usuario\AppData\Local\Microsoft\Excel\XLStart.
¿Qué se puede hacer con una macro de Excel?
Con macros en Excel puedes crear y modificar funciones, formularios, tablas, aplicaciones complejas, etc. Es como cualquier función de Excel pero que puedes programar para que haga lo que tú quieras.
¿Qué se puede hacer con una macro en Excel?
Habilitar macros en Excel asegura obtener los resultados programados sin que ocurran errores que signifiquen gastos adicionales. Una macro ejecuta una secuencia de tareas que toma tiempo hacer, por lo tanto, al ejecutarlas de forma automática, los profesionales pueden enfocarse en otras prioridades.
¿Qué se puede hacer con VBA?
En líneas generales, VBA es conveniente utilizarlo cuando hay que hacer tareas repetitivas en Excel o cálculos muy complicados de una forma manual. En estas situaciones, sería conveniente programar una determinada tarea, o varias, para poder ejecutarla con un simple botón o mediante la configuración de un comando.
¿Qué tipo de lenguaje de programación es Visual Basic?
Visual Basic (VB) es un lenguaje de programación dirigido por eventos. Desarrollado por Alan Cooper para Microsoft, este lenguaje de programación es un dialecto de BASIC con importantes agregados.
¿Cómo hacer un programa en Excel que diga hola mundo?
Para abrir Visual Basic, presione Ctrl+G. En el panel de ventana Inmediato, escriba Print MsgBox("Hello World"),y, a continuación, presione Entrar. Un cuadro de diálogo de Access muestra el mensaje.
¿Cómo se llama el elemento dónde se crean las aplicaciones de Visual Basic?
Un entorno de desarrollo integrado (IDE) es un programa con numerosas características que respalda muchos aspectos del desarrollo de software. El IDE de Visual Studio es un panel de inicio creativo que se puede usar para editar, depurar y compilar código y, después, publicar una aplicación.
¿Qué beneficios tiene el macro?
En palabras simples, una macro es un conjunto de comandos que se almacena en un archivo de Excel para que el usuario la ejecute cuando lo desee. El objetivo principal de esta funcionalidad es agilizar los flujos de trabajo mediante la automatización de tareas monótonas, repetitivas y rutinarias.
¿Cómo se activan las macros?
Configuración de las macros en Microsoft Office
Sitúate en el punto "Archivo/ Opciones" y accede a "Centro de confianza". A continuación, pulsa sobre el botón "Configuración del Centro de confianza". En "Configuración de macros" activa la opción "Habilitar todas las macros".
¿Cómo hacer una macro en el teclado?
- Seleccione Archivo > Comandos de teclado.
- Haga clic en Mostrar macros.
- Haga clic en Nueva macro.
- Introduzca un nombre para la macro y pulse Retorno para confirmarlo.
- En la parte media superior del diálogo, seleccione el primer comando que quiera incluir en la macro.
- Haga clic en Añadir comando.
¿Qué es un libro sin macros en Excel?
Se trata de un libro oculto almacenado en el equipo, que se abre cada vez que inicie Excel. Vea crear y guardar todas las macros en un solo libro para obtener información sobre cómo hacerlo.
¿Cuando no es posible ejecutar una macro?
Las macros están deshabilitadas de manera predeterminada porque se crean con el código de Visual Basic que puede afectar de manera negativa el equipo si se escribe o graba con mala intención.
¿Cómo copiar una macro de un libro a otro Excel?
Abra tanto el libro que contiene la macro que desea copiar como el libro donde desea copiarlo. En la pestaña Programador, haga clic en Visual Basic para abrir el editor Visual Basic. o presione CTRL+R . En el Project explorador, arrastre el módulo que contiene la macro que desea copiar al libro de destino.
¿Cómo se guarda una macro en un archivo?
Guardar una macro con el libro actual
Para guardarlo como libro habilitado para macros: Haga clic en No. En el cuadro Guardar como , en el cuadro de lista Guardar como tipo , elija Excel Macro-Enabled libro (*. xlsm).
¿Cómo abrir el Editor de Visual Basic en Excel?
- Haga clic en Archivo > Opciones.
- Haga clic en Personalizar cinta de opcionesy, a continuación, en Pestañas principales, active la casilla Programador.
- Haga clic en Aceptar.
¿Cómo se guarda un documento con macros en Word?
Haga clic en el Botón de Microsoft Office y, a continuación, haga clic en Opciones de Word. En el panel izquierdo, haga clic en Guardar. En la lista Guardar archivos en este formato , haga clic en Documento de Word Macro-Enabled (*. docm)y, a continuación, haga clic en Aceptar.
¿Cómo se consigue el bronce?
¿Cómo regalar saldo de Movistar a Movistar?